The media reports suggesting that a foreign military base was established in Azerbaijan are groundless and untrue.
The statement came from Ramiz Tahirov, deputy defense minister, commander of Air Force of Azerbaijan, who spoke on July 21, according to the Azeri Newspaper.
He was commenting on some media reports claiming that a military base of Turkish Armed Forces was established in Azerbaijan.
Tahirov said that according to the protocol earlier approved by Azerbaijan's president, a building located in the Gyzyl Sherg military town, used since '90s, was rented to the office of military attache of Turkey in Azerbaijan.
The protocol makes it possible for the renter to carry out repair and reconstruction works in that building, added Tahirov.
